Vascular Laboratory

The Stanford Vascular Laboratory is a specialized diagnostic facility that is accredited by the Intersocietal Commission for the Accreditation of Vascular Laboratories (ICAVL).

The Vascular Laboratory's purpose is to serve health care providers and their patients by utilizing advanced, noninvasive, diagnostic, medical ultrasound technology while ensuring high quality results.

Examinations are performed by clinically skilled Registered Vascular Technologists with specialized training.
